If you wants to add class to something, getting Morgan Freeman to do the voiceover is always a good way to go. Now the actor has added his dulcet tone to a new marriage equality ad for the Human Rights Campaign, called ‘Dawn of a New Day for Marriage Equality’. He wants Americans to get behind gay marriage, saying “Now, across our country, we’re standing together for the right of gay and lesbian Americans to marry the person they love.”
The US has just had historic victories for equal marriage, with voters approving same sex marriage (and blocking the banning of it) in polls in Maine, Maryland, Minnesota and Washington. While various measures have been put to voters in the last few years concerning equal marriage, this was the first time voters had gone in favour of gay partnerships.
However Freeman wants us to know that just because we’ve had some victories, there’s still a long way to go and the momentum needs to be maintained if equality is going to spread to other states.
Morgan has long supported gay rights, making many smile when he tweeted earlier this year, “I hate the word homophobia. It’s not a phobia. You are not scared. You are an asshole.”
